Let’s face it, finding time to plan a wedding is no easy feat. Couples in 2015 spend about 15 hours a week planning their wedding according to a recent WeddingWire survey, and that’s bound to cut into some of your time at the office.

We’ve figured out how you can plan your wedding at work and still ace the performance review at the end of the quarter.


Email vendors
Corresponding with vendors during the work day is an under-the-radar way to plan. According to a recent WeddingWire survey, 77% of couples prefer to use email when communicating with a vendor. If you're able to access your personal email at work it’s an easy way to confirm pricing, set up tastings, and schedule appointments without your boss noticing!

Read vendor contracts
Nothing looks more professional than pulling up a PDF with a small font that’s multiple pages long. Take this time to read every word of the contracts your vendor sends you. Before you sign it, make sure to share with your S.O. and make a list of questions you may have. If something seems off, don’t hesitate to ask! It’s better to be safe than sorry.
